We are living in extraordinary times. Artificial Intelligence (AI) is not just a trendy marketing term, it is a part of our daily lives changing how we search, shop, talk, and create.

When we witness AI recommending a next binge-watch program to facilitating realistic artwork in seconds, we are realizing its capabilities. One of the most exciting exploits currently being developed is web development.

Web development used to be 100% human, but characterized many hours spent coding, testing, debugging, and designing!

So here we are now in 2025, with intelligent tools that will automate, assist, or even do some tasks of web design and development for you.

So what will we discuss in this article? We will look at:

  • The definition of AI in a web context
  • How it is changing the web-dev development process
  • The best AI tools for web dev in 2025
  • The best benefits and biggest downfalls
  • Real life examples
  • Moving it forward into our future web projects
  • And of course the most common FAQ’s.

The Growth of AI in Web Development

Artificial intelligence (AI) is rapidly becoming one of the most significant factors shaping web development today, and is changing the way websites are designed and launched.

According to Statista, the market for AI software will be valued at over $126 billion by 2025 showing it is making waves in web development.

As per Statista, The AI software market is estimated to reach $126 billion by 2025, indicating its significant impact on web development.

Another study by Epsilon states, that 80% of consumers favor companies that offer individualized experiences, proving the effectiveness of artificial intelligence in increasing conversion rates.

AI is transforming the development process, from coding automation to more creative user interface design.

AI’s potential grows as technology advances, presenting new opportunities and problems for developers and organizations alike.

What is AI in Web Development?

Defining Artificial Intelligence in the Web Context

Let’s start simple: Artificial Intelligence (AI) refers to the ability of machines to mimic human intelligence. In the realm of web development, this means systems that can make decisions, learn from data, recognize patterns, and automate tasks.

In standard programming, developers provide explicit instructions to machines. But AI systems—especially those based on machine learning (ML)—don’t follow pre-defined scripts.

Instead, they learn from past data and outcomes to make decisions or improve performance.

How AI is influencing the Web Development Industry

AI is revolutionizing web development by assisting developers in many aspects like code generation, UX personalization, testing and debugging, content generation, and design automation.

Tools like GitHub Copilot and Tabnine use AI to suggest and write code based on natural language prompts. Whereas, AI analyzes user behavior to provide customized website experiences.

It can run thousands of test scenarios, identify bugs, and recommend fixes, cutting QA time by half.

AI-powered tools can generate engaging content that aligns with user intent and ranking goals.

The design automation tools can analyze current design trends and automatically suggest or generate UI/UX layouts, eliminating the need for Photoshop expertise.

What are the top AI Tools for Web Development in 2025?

Here’s a curated list of the best AI-powered tools for web development in 2025:

AI tools for Coding

AI-Powered CodingtoolsFeatures
TabnineIt provides AI-powered code completion and context-aware suggestions.
GitHub CopilotThis tool helps with code completion by offering recommendations as you type.
Amazon CodeWhispererIt offers AI-powered code suggestions in your IDE. 

Website maker AI tools

AI website builder freetoolsFeatures
HubSpot’s AI Website GeneratorHubSpot automates website creation.
10WebIt’s an AI-powered tool for building feature-rich websites.

AI tools for Testing and Debugging

AI-Powered Testing and Debugging toolsFeatures
DeepCodeThis app uses AI to scan code for defects and vulnerabilities.
SnykIt helps find and solve security flaws in code.

AI tools for Content Generation and SEO

AI-Powered Content Generation and SEO toolsFeatures
AI Content GenieThis tool generates text and graphics from simple descriptions.
ChatGPTIt can help with content production, SEO optimization, and chatbot development.

AI tools for Design and User Interface

AI-Powered Design and User Interface toolsWhat does these tools provide
UizardUizard is an AI-powered design tool that allows you to rapidly and easily create websites and user interfaces.
WixWix is an AI website builder that automates design tasks.
CanvaThis tool provides AI-powered design suggestions and templates.
Designs.AIDesign.AI is an artificial intelligence platform that creates and scales content.

These web development AI tools help bridge the gap between creativity and technology, allowing developers and designers to move faster and with greater precision.

Key Benefits of AI in Web Development

Why is everyone jumping on the AI bandwagon in web development? Here are some compelling reasons:

1. Improved Precision

Al-assisted software development’s effective algorithms provide increased precision. These techniques help developers identify mistakes and weaknesses in code by detecting trends and unusual behavior.

As a result, there are fewer errors and problems, which lowers downtime and enhances customer satisfaction.

Al is also able to identify and implement best practices in development, guaranteeing software that is correct, quick, resilient, and future-proof.

Businesses gain from this since it lowers errors, decreases downtime, and improves customer satisfaction.

2. Enhanced Efficiency

By automating activities, the Al system allows developers to concentrate on more imaginative areas of outsourcing Al creation.

Code is tested and optimized by Al algorithms, freeing up engineers and developers to work on new projects.

According to research, Al can present and analyze code to enhance developers’ work and increase software development productivity.

3. Improved Partnership

By recommending code modifications and providing real-time feedback, Al algorithms promote developer cooperation, resulting in better software and more efficient communication.

Additionally, they facilitate code merging, which lowers conflict and facilitates collaboration.

4. All-Accessible

Al-assisted development improves the abilities of current developers and removes the need for in-depth knowledge of coding or machine learning. It makes software development approachable to non-technical individuals.

This enables non-technical individuals to develop chatbots and voice assistants, automate operations, and resolve business problems.

5. Improved Scalability

Al algorithms are useful because they can save time and effort by handling larger and more complicated software projects efficiently.  

As projects get bigger and more complicated, they maximize development efforts, cut down on delays, and guarantee project completion on time.

6. Advanced personalization

Al-assisted development tools improve software development processes, product quality, reliability, and user experience by allowing for individualized and adaptive interfaces.

These apps use ML algorithms to evaluate user behavior, building adaptable interfaces that respond to individual tastes, resulting in faster interactions, higher user satisfaction, and retention.

Also Read: A Beginner’s Guide to Build a Website on Shopify in 2025

Major Drawbacks of Using AI in Web Development

Of course, no technology is perfect. While AI for Web Development has massive upside, it’s important to be aware of its limitations:

1. High initial investment

Al-assisted software development has several advantages, but it needs a considerable initial investment of time and resources.

Implementing Al algorithms can be time-consuming and demanding on resources, ranging from $50,000 for simple models to more than $500,000 for complex ones, depending on the breadth and complexity.

2. Creativity is limited

Algorithms that follow rigid rules and procedures may not generate novel ideas or solutions.

Considering their ability to train on enormous quantities of data and produce predictions, their stringent restrictions may prevent them from thinking creatively or coming up with novel ideas.

3. Biases and Inaccuracies

The data used for training Artificial Neural Network (Al) algorithms can be distorted, resulting in erroneous predictions and results.

The success of all algorithms is determined by the data on which they are trained; if the data is biased, the algorithms will be impacted as well, thus affecting the software development process.

4. Dependency on algorithms

Over-dependence on Al algorithms can result in a lack of creativity and critical thinking among software developers, reducing their reliance on their own expertise and problem-solving abilities.

This can lead to a decline in originality and creativity, lowering overall software quality and perhaps impeding the growth and development of the software development industry.

Practical Applications

Let’s look at examples of AI for Web Development by industry:

1. AI Chatbots and virtual assistants

AI chatbots and virtual assistants enhance client engagements by adding immediate communication, answering questions, and assisting in web navigation, and this has produced better user satisfaction.

2. AI Smart Code Automation

AI tools, such as GitHub Copilot and Tabnine, help developers by performing repetitive work, including creating Python AI frameworks.

By speeding up developments and reducing human errors, it allows for more diverse, creative, and complex tasks.

3. AI for Debugging Websites, Testing and Security

AI eliminates human interaction for website tests by performing simulations that identify errors, bugs and performance issues.

Selenium and Testim.io are some inferior examples of tools that find errors in web development. AI security offerings on websites use algorithms to identify threats and “real-time” security while buffering against hacking attempts.

4. AI optimized SEO and Content generating

AI’s role in SEO is vital as it collates user data and changes website content through Websites/Sites, resulting in better positioning in search engines repair.

Clearscope and Surfer SEO were powerful with AI to identify keywords and create the content better optimized as they represent the user with an increased engagement leads to visibility and increased conversion!

Future of AI in Web Development

AI is changing the web development industry by automating coding, testing and design optimization tasks, but it isn’t likely to replace web developers completely.

Rather, it will be a great asset while interpreting and enhancing the developer’s powers, while speeding up the time it takes to complete projects.

Developers will continue to hold a vital role in regards to the decision-making of AI instruments, integrating the system in the code, and anticipating if AI generated answers fit with the company mission and users needs.

Although AI may complete mundane tasks, write code or design, the creative engineer who provides more challenging problem-solving skills to projects will always be needed.

The landscape of the future of AI and web development is undefined, with AI assistants and human developers pulling together to develop even smarter, faster, better websites and services.

Want to know more?Visit-Web Development Services | startup Rabbit

FAQs

Q1. What are the pros and cons of AI in web development?

AI in web development provides pros such as faster creation, improved user experiences, and higher SEO via data analysis, but it also has cons such as lack of creativity, potential bias, and ethical issues.

Q2. What are the benefits and drawbacks of AI?

AI provides benefits such as enhanced efficiency, accuracy, and automation, but it also introduces drawbacks such as employment displacement, ethical concerns, and the possibility of bias. When designing and deploying AI systems, both benefits and drawbacks must be considered.

Q3. Which AI tool is best for website development?

For web development, GitHub Copilot comes out as a powerful AI-powered coding assistant that provides real-time code suggestions and completion. Other notable competitors include AI for website design like Uizard, as well as those focusing on specific issues such as security with Snyk and code review with DeepCode.

Q4. How is AI used in web development?

AI is revolutionizing web development by automating activities, improving user experience, and introducing new methods for creating and optimizing websites. AI can help with code generation, design, testing, and content creation, resulting in more efficient and successful web development workflows.

Conclusion

A Quick Recap

In this article, we explored:

  • What AI for Web Development is and how it’s evolving
  • Top tools transforming the field in 2025
  • Key benefits like efficiency, personalization, and cost savings
  • Important drawbacks include creativity loss and ethical concerns
  • Real-world applications across industries
  • What the future of AI in web projects might look like

Final Thoughts

AI won’t replace human developers, but it will empower them. It’s a powerful assistant—smart, tireless, and incredibly fast. But like all tools, its effectiveness depends on how you use it.

So whether you’re a freelancer building your next client site or a startup looking to scale fast—embracing AI for Web Development might just be your competitive edge in this rapidly evolving digital age.